I've posted a lot on this particular issue, but I'll repeat one key point: the mistake that the Republicans really made was to offer the ability to invest Social Security contributions in equities instead.

While that's the right thing to do in the long-term, it opened the door for endless demagoguery by the Democrats, when the inevitable downturn in equities occurred.

What they SHOULD have offered (and what Ryan is offering), is the ability to invest those funds in long-term government bonds -- just like the Social Security "trust fund". The key difference would have been OWNERSHIP of that asset -- you would have been able to pass it on to your children if you died prematurely.

The Republicans squandered a real opportunity in the early 2000's, and now I fear it's too late.
